Tucker Zimmerman Trades Vocals With Big Thief’s Adrianne Lenker On Final ‘Dance Of Love’ Preview ‘Lorelei’

The singer-songwriter’s 11th album is due to arrive on Friday, October 11.

By Andy Kahn Oct 8, 2024 9:45 am PDT

Tucker Zimmerman shared the single, “Lorelei,” featuring the veteran singer-songwriter volleying between verses with Big Thief’s Adrianne Lenker. The song is the final preview of the Belgium-based, American-born Zimmerman’s pending album, Dance Of Love, which will be released through 4AD this Friday, October 11.

Dance Of Love was recorded by Zimmerman with the aid of Lenker and her Big Thief bandmates — Buck Meek and ​​James Krivchenia — and the band’s close collaborators Mat Davidson and Zach Burba. Zimmerman’s wife Marie-Claire Zimmerman also contributed to the album.

One of 10 songs making up the Big Thief-produced Dance Of Love, “Lorelei” was described by Zimmerman, who stated:

“I’m turning Lorelei on her head in this song. Enough luring sailors on the river to their destruction. Time to head for the hills with a silver harp and bring some peace into the world.”
